All Geddy Starheart wanted was to get out of the game. Cash in his chips and stop running product for the infamous Double A auction. But when a routine trip dangles that very opportunity, one question remains: What’s the catch? It was supposed to be a routine job. Pick up the artifact on Ceonus and bring it back to his boss on Kigantu. In, out, done, as easy as making love. But the seller, an eccentric trillionaire with a dark soul, inconveniently died while he was en route. Now he’s got to convince with the guy’s weird, clueless stepson to honor the deal.
When a stranger makes a proposal that would let him walk away for good, he's never been more tempted. But to get to the bottom of it, he must be willing to betray some very powerful people — and survive one insane night on the town.
Geddy's Gambit is a prequel tale for Reassembly, C.P. James' new and seriously funny space opera series. Fans of grown-up sci-fi humor like Guardians of the Galaxy, Firefly, Galaxy Quest,and The Orville will love this fresh, irreverent, noirish take on the genre.
I write cinematic sci-fi of substance. What does that mean?
My love of writing came from reading, of course, but my love of story really came from movies. Expect smart characters and short chapters that move along at a cinematic pace. I like intricate, plausible stories that reward careful readers without alienating those who just want to kick back and escape this messed-up world for a while.
I currently have two series: Reassembly, a humorous space opera with six books, and a dystopian trilogy, The Cytocorp Saga. I expect to release the first book in a new sci-fi series sometime in mid 2026.
